Hope you dont mind a question. Do you think your swing speed was impacted much by PMR or prednisone? PMR hit me early this season and my swing speed has really declined? Although it could just be age--I'm 63.

Absolutely swing speed affected, assuming you are connecting consistently in the club's sweet spot. I have reduced back swing to increase accuracy and make sure compressing ball. Shoulders ache somewhat so that reduces swing plane range. I hope with further tapering, more range of motion prevails. Still looking for alternatives, but hydrochlorothiazide, cyclobenzaprine hydrochloride or meloxicam do not seem to work for me. Prednizone is nasty stuff (but required I surmise)!
